How does digital fabrication help in creating personalized healthcare solutions for patients?

Digital fabrication, which includes 3D printing, laser cutting, and CNC machining, allows for the creation of customized and personalized healthcare solutions for patients. Here are some ways in which it helps:

1. Flexible Design: Traditional manufacturing techniques have limitations when it comes to designing custom-fit solutions. Digital fabrication allows designers to create complex and intricate designs that can be tailored to the needs of individual patients.

2. Rapid Prototyping: Digital fabrication enables the rapid prototyping of medical devices and prosthetics, which can speed up the development process and get patients the help they need faster.

3. Improved Accuracy: Customized healthcare solutions require a high degree of accuracy. Digital fabrication technologies offer precision and accuracy that traditional manufacturing techniques cannot match.

4. Cost-Effective: Digital fabrication is often more cost-effective than traditional manufacturing techniques when it comes to creating customized healthcare solutions.

5. Patient Comfort: Custom-made medical devices and prosthetics offer better fit and comfort for patients, which can improve their quality of life.

6. Patient-Specific Implants: Digital fabrication enables the creation of patient-specific implants that can be tailored to the individual’s anatomy. This ensures a better fit and reduces the risk of complications.

Overall, digital fabrication is proving to be a game-changer in the healthcare industry, offering personalized solutions that can improve patients’ health outcomes.
